Before downloading a driver, confirm that your device belongs to Nuvoton: Right-click the and select Device Manager . Expand the Ports (COM & LPT) or Unknown Devices section. Right-click the problematic port and select Properties . Go to the Details tab. Select Hardware Ids from the Property dropdown menu.
Right-click the device and select Update driver .

If your driver version is below 1.0.0.0, replace it. If you are running a driver dated 2016 or earlier, upgrade. The "sweet spot" for most Windows 10 22H2 users is a driver signed between 2020 and 2023 with version numbers starting with 2.x or 3.x .
Download the latest available version from the OEM, even if it was built for Windows 8 or 7, as these often carry valid legacy signatures that Windows 10 accepts.
